Grandview Heights Elementary School (Closed 2013)

2342 Clifton
Memphis, TN 38127
(School attendance zone shown in map)
Grandview Heights Elementary School serves 472 students in grades Prekindergarten-6. 
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math was 22% (which was lower than the Tennessee state average of 49%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ts was 16% (which was lower than the Tennessee state average of 52%).
The student-teacher ratio of 16:1 was higher than the Tennessee state level of 15:1.
Minority enrollment was 98% of the student body (majority Black), which was higher than the Tennessee state average of 43% (majority Black).
